How many psi in 1 ft Hg? The answer is 5.8938498267194. We assume you are converting between pound/square inch and foot mercury [0 °C]. You can view more details on each measurement unit: psi or ft Hg The SI derived unit for pressure is the pascal. 1 pascal is equal to 0.00014503773800722 psi, or 2.4608319226204E-5 ft Hg. The pound per square inch or, more accurately, pound-force per square inch (symbol: psi or lbf/in² or lbf/in²) is a unit of pressure or of stress based on avoirdupois units. It is the pressure resulting from a force of one pound-force applied to an area of one square inch.
